![]() This provides an override for forcing the daemon to still attempt running the devicemapper driver even when udev sync is not supported. Intended to be a very clear impairment for those choosing to use it. If udev sync is false, there will still be an error in the daemon logs, even when the override is in place. The docs have an explicit WARNING. Including link to the docs for users that encounter this daemon error during an upgrade. Signed-off-by: Vincent Batts <vbatts@redhat.com> |
